Program Strengths
Key Strengths of the
Med/Peds Program
- Established in 1967 as one of the original two Med/Peds programs
in the United States
- Broad and complete support from two strong departments, each with
its own high-quality categorical residency program
- A combined-trained program director
- A newly designed and renovated combined ambulatory training site
with outstanding staff
- A fifth-year chief resident dedicated to the specific needs of
the Med/Peds residents
- Balanced clinical experiences in both university and community
hospitals
- A diverse group of energetic, friendly, intelligent residents
with wonderful senses of humor
- Flexibility of electives and elective scheduling
- A humane and collegial training environment which is responsive
to each resident's particular needs
- A vibrant, livable, and culturally rich community which employs
at least 15 combined-trained physicians as role models and mentors
